Output e8cc60aafb96ad1e34729c986851c3de354ed0926638e3b70fc4a4fa0b5bd50f:1

value
75595508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b4af54c0cebc2fcce67b1de3b322db806892c1 OP_EQUAL
address
M9svsfWBdPNfikhZTU84Sf7t6FbWeHFy8X
transaction
e8cc60aafb96ad1e34729c986851c3de354ed0926638e3b70fc4a4fa0b5bd50f
spent
true